Thousands of asylum-seekers at the border, the trump administration has instituted a practice known as metering. the procedure is meant to help alleviate the pressure on the border by limiting the number of asylum-seekers allowed to enter the country each day. once they present solves at a port of entry. seems kind of reasonable given the limited resources we have. not according to the advocacy group, the activist legal aid group is slapping the trump administration with the class action lawsuit over the practic practice. melissa crow, an attorney with the southern poverty law center s immigration justice project says the goal is to get cbp to comply with the law which requires them to process the asylum-seekers at ports of entry. the law requires them to admit legitimate asylum-seekers into the country. last fiscal years immigration judges found only about 9% of all those emigrants qualified. ....
